0

我遇到了 Facebook 页面的静态 HTML 应用程序,它允许我们构建一个由 HTML、CSS 甚至 Javascript 组成的登录页面。例如。http://www.facebook.com/divethegap?sk=app_190322544333196

现在可以与父窗口交互。如果可能的话,我想将整体背景更改为其他内容,最好是我们网站上的图像。

作为一个测试我试过$('body', window.parent.document).css('background-color', '#888');

什么都没发生。我可以想象为什么 facebook 会限制或完全限制修改父窗口的能力的许多原因,但是对于父级的 CSS,我想知道这是否可能。它肯定会大大照亮整个主题。

4

1 回答 1

0

这是因为跨域访问限制,如果父窗口不在同一个域中,您将无法从父窗口访问任何内容。

于 2012-02-01T16:12:16.263 回答